Coroner confirms murder of man found dead 16 years ago

📌 Diğer 📰 Australia 🕐 5 saat önce

A coroner has found the investigation into a Broome tradies' murder, which remains an enduring mystery, was mishandled by WA Police.

A coroner has determined that Josh Warneke, who was found dead on a road in Broome 16 years ago, was likely murdered. The investigation concluded that he suffered fatal head injuries from blunt force trauma. The coroner criticized the initial police investigation for significant forensic shortcomings and insufficient resources. The case has remained unsolved despite previous charges and an overturned conviction. The findings may lead to renewed efforts to find those responsible. Warneke was last seen on CCTV at a McDonald's drive-thru before his body was discovered. His family and the local community have long sought answers. The coroner has referred the case to authorities for further review. The lack of justice has left lasting impacts on the community. The investigation highlighted systemic issues in regional policing. The case remains a significant unresolved mystery in the area.
